All Categories
Featured
Table of Contents
We likewise utilize Google Jamboard for the design round. Our meeting procedure at Opn is straightforward, and we guarantee you are well-prepared for the technological rounds.
The technical interview contains two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 mins to reply to inquiries and 10 minutes for Q&A. Depending on the schedule of both the prospect and the recruiter, these rounds might happen on various days.
Maybe, it has been a long period of time considering that you last touched them, so take adequate time to go back to exercise. Recognize the principles, study the syntax extremely carefully, and get acquainted with different means of reacting to the questions. During the meeting, before trying to compose your service, you might wish to first clear up the concern with the recruiter, assess the problem, and detail the logic and why you will certainly choose this technique to fixing the problem.
It is essential to explain that the interviewers want you to do well and are there to support you. The whole idea for you is to reveal the interviewer how you assume, connect, and whether you can address problems. By doing so, you have actually opened the flooring to engage much more with the recruiter and welcome any kind of suggestions connected with tackling the coding problems.
Still, it is common among our job interviewers to ask inquiries around the subject of payment portals as this will certainly be most appropriate to your daily work. In the layout round, candidates are encouraged to provide their perfect software architecture style to carry out a hypothetical solution under particular restraints. Concerns can consist of: Style a settlement system for an e-commerce platform.
When being talked to and throughout coding rounds, it's handy to repeat the questions to the recruiter to guarantee that both of you are on the very same page. If you don't understand, feel totally free to ask the job interviewer to repeat or rephrase the inquiry.
I've been a full desk technological employer for virtually 10 years. Many of my time has actually been invested as a firm recruiter with Code Talent, yet I additionally have a year of interior recruiting experience on Twitter's Earnings Platform group.
I want to flag that the recommendations provided is based upon my personal viewpoints and experience, and ought to not be considered a recommendation of the working with procedures made use of in big technology, or by companies emulating big tech hiring. Rather, it is planned to provide assistance on how to navigate the "industry standard" interview procedure and boost your chances of success.
Yet in all severity, you can inform a lot concerning your positioning to a company and their values based upon this page. In addition, sites like Glassdoor and Blind can provide important insights right into the company's interview process, worker experiences, and salaries. It's also an excellent concept to investigate your interviewer and their role to get a much better understanding of their viewpoint and what they might be seeking in a prospect.
Just how has the interview procedure been so much? Commonly our impulses are effective devices that are overlooked; it's vital to resolve any kind of appointments concerning the role or firm before proceeding with the procedure. Self-reflect throughout the whole process and do it often! Do you have a mentor? There are many reasons that it is necessary to have an excellent mentor, but in this case, it's optimal for technique.
Deal with every practice as an interview; it could also assist with those game day nerves! In the 'Understanding is Power' section, I mentioned the importance of identifying firm values.
Furthermore, the STAR technique will certainly help you produce answers to potential behavior interview concerns. Create STAR instances for each and every bullet in the work summary (if there are also lots of bullets, collect motifs). Behavioral interview questions are frequently taken straight from these task description bullet factors. : Strong problem-solving abilities, with the capacity to assume creatively and purposefully to fix complicated technological difficulties -> Inform me concerning a time you ran into challenges and difficulties at work.
How? By showing good cooperation abilities, discussing their believed procedures, and most significantly, their errors. If you can verbalize your f-ups and "could-have-beens" well, you could simply get the job. Usually, it's even more concerning your approach and your capacity to be an excellent teammate than your remedy. Throughout the technical meeting, maintain these inquiries in mind: Have you collected your demands? Do you recognize what you're doing? Are you inspecting in with your recruiter? They're there to team up with you.
Are you bewildered? Request for a moment. It's alright to relax. Can you scale your service? If so, just how? Are you over-engineering? Lastly, come prepared with your own questions for the job interviewer. Review your toughness, weak points, interests, and opportunities for growth. Being honest and susceptible (when secure) can assist you stick out from other prospects.
Bear in mind, you're freaking incredible, and your unique qualities and experiences can help you land your desire work as long as it's the ideal suitable for you. Are you still not feeling good regarding this? All great, and I completely understand. Right here's a checklist of firms that do not whiteboard or follow "conventional technology" meeting processes, phew.
Do take a look at all these concerns with answers from below: Software Application Design Meeting Questions is the process of creating, creating, screening, and maintaining software. It is a methodical and regimented method to software growth that intends to develop high-grade, reputable, and maintainable software application. Software program engineers develop software application remedies for end users by making use of engineering concepts and their understanding of programming languages.
It is a qualities of software application that refers to its ability to perform what it was developed to do properly and constantly gradually. It describes the extent to which the software can be utilized effortlessly. The amount of initiative or time needed to learn how to utilize the software application.
It refers to exactly how simple it is to boost and modify the software. It describes exactly how conveniently a software system can be changed to include feature, boost rate, or repair work faults. It refers to just how well the software can deal with various systems or situations without making significant adjustments.
For even more details please refer to the following write-up Characteristics of Software program. The software program is used thoroughly in several domain names including medical facilities, banks, schools, protection, money, securities market, and more. It can be classified into various types: For even more information please refer to the adhering to write-up Classifications of Software program.
It is characterized by a structured, sequential technique to task administration and software program development. Needs Gathering and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Needs are clear and fixed that may not change. There are no unclear needs (no confusion). It is good to use this design when the innovation is well recognized.
Beta testing commonly uses black-box testing. Alpha screening is carried out by testers that are usually internal staff members of the organization. Beta testing is performed by customers that are not component of the organization. Alpha screening is executed at the developer's website. Beta testing is executed at the end-user, the of the item.
Reliability, protection, and toughness are examined throughout beta testing. Alpha screening makes certain the quality of the item before forwarding it to beta testing. Beta testing likewise focuses on the top quality of the item however gathers the customer's time-long input on the item and makes certain that the product awaits real-time customers.
Table of Contents
Latest Posts
How To Break Down A Coding Problem In A Software Engineering Interview
10 Biggest Myths About Faang Technical Interviews
How To Pass The Interview For Software Engineering Roles – Step-by-step Guide
More
Latest Posts
How To Break Down A Coding Problem In A Software Engineering Interview
10 Biggest Myths About Faang Technical Interviews
How To Pass The Interview For Software Engineering Roles – Step-by-step Guide